What companies run services between Spring Lake, NJ, USA and O2 Arena, Czechia?

There is no direct connection from Spring Lake to O2 Arena. However, you can take the train to Long Branch, take the train to Newark Airport Railroad Station, walk to Newark Airport Amtrak, take the vehicle to Terminal B, walk to Newark Liberty International Airport (EWR) airport, fly to Václav Havel Airport Prague (PRG), walk to Václav Havel Airport T1, take the line 59 train to Nádraží Veleslavín, walk to Nádraží Veleslavín, take the subway to Hradčanská, walk to Hradčanská, take the line 8 vehicle to Arena Libeň jih, then walk to O2 Arena. Alternatively, you can take the train to Long Branch, take the train to New York Penn Station, take the train to Jamaica, walk to Jamaica Station, take the vehicle to Terminal 4, walk to John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K) airport, fly to Václav Havel Airport Prague (PRG), walk to Václav Havel Airport T1, take the line 59 train to Nádraží Veleslavín, walk to Nádraží Veleslavín, take the subway to Hradčanská, walk to Hradčanská, take the line 8 vehicle to Arena Libeň jih, then walk to O2 Arena.
